在数字化时代,表单数据安全已成为一个不容忽视的问题。无论是个人用户还是企业,都面临着数据泄露的潜在风险。本文将深入探讨表单数据安全的重要性,分析常见的风险点,并提供实用的防护措施,帮助你守护隐私防线。
一、表单数据安全的重要性
1. 隐私保护
表单数据通常包含用户的个人信息,如姓名、地址、电话号码、身份证号码等。一旦这些信息泄露,用户可能会遭受身份盗窃、诈骗等严重后果。
2. 法律法规要求
根据《中华人民共和国网络安全法》等相关法律法规,企业有义务保护用户数据安全,否则将面临罚款、停业等处罚。
3. 企业声誉
数据泄露会导致企业声誉受损,影响客户信任,进而影响业务发展。
二、常见风险点
1. 数据传输过程中的泄露
当用户通过表单提交数据时,数据会在客户端和服务器之间传输。如果传输过程不加密,数据可能被截获。
2. 数据存储过程中的泄露
存储在服务器上的数据如果未加密,也可能被非法访问。
3. 系统漏洞
服务器或应用程序可能存在漏洞,攻击者可以利用这些漏洞获取数据。
三、防护措施
1. 数据传输加密
使用HTTPS协议确保数据在传输过程中的加密,防止数据被截获。
// 示例:使用HTTPS发送数据
fetch('https://example.com/api/submit', {
method: 'POST',
headers: {
'Content-Type': 'application/json'
},
body: JSON.stringify({ key: 'value' })
});
2. 数据存储加密
对存储在服务器上的数据进行加密,确保即使数据被非法访问,也无法解读。
-- 示例:使用SQL加密存储数据
CREATE TABLE users (
id INT PRIMARY KEY,
username VARCHAR(255) NOT NULL,
password VARBINARY(255) NOT NULL
);
3. 及时修复系统漏洞
定期更新服务器和应用程序,修复已知漏洞。
4. 数据访问控制
限制对数据的访问权限,确保只有授权人员才能访问。
# 示例:Python中的数据访问控制
def access_data(user):
if user.is_authorized:
# 允许访问数据
data = get_data()
return data
else:
# 拒绝访问
return None
5. 数据备份
定期备份数据,以防数据丢失。
# 示例:使用bash备份数据
tar -czvf data_backup.tar.gz /path/to/data
四、总结
表单数据安全是每个人都应该关注的问题。通过采取上述措施,可以有效降低数据泄露的风险,守护你的隐私防线。同时,企业和个人应提高安全意识,共同营造安全、健康的网络环境。
